Fractional superstrings with space-time critical dimensions four and six

We propose possible new string theories based on local world-sheet symmetries corresponding to extensions of the Virasoro algebra by fractional-spin currents. They have critical central charges {ital c}=6({ital K}+8)/({ital K}+2) and Minkowski space-time dimensions {ital D}=2+16/{ital K} for {ital K}{ge}2 an integer. We present evidence for their existence by constructing modular-invariant partition functions and the massless particle spectra. The dimension 4 and 6 strings have space-time supersymmetry.
